One can choose any profile and start their career in the field of game development. Game developers include artists, sound designers, game designers, and programmers. Each position requires different education and training. Many universities offer classes or majors in video game development.

Excellent and in-depth knowledge of computer programming to be used for gaming.

Pay Scale for a Game Developer

Advanced algebra, geometry, and trigonometry help programmers translate real-world motion of objects into computer code. Programmers should know programming languages, at least C and C++, and they should learn new computer programming languages quickly. A Bachelor of Science in Computer Science is a good educational start.
